DB2 开发系列 第三部分 DB2数据库的备份   备份数据库有脱机和联机两种方式能够进行数据库的备份操作:一:脱机备份:    脱机备份需要对数据库的独占存取权。在可进行备份操作之前,所有用户必须与数据库或 数据库分区断开,在分区数据库环境中,若正在执行编目节点的脱机备份,则整个数据库上不能有任何活动。在数据库初始建立的时候,由于数据
导读对应db2迁移到mysql方案在网上都是使用navcat,这个种方案在生产环境不现实,因为生产环境基本上时命令行方式,所以优先想到的是使用命令行到处txt文件,然后导入mysql,使用kettle等etl工具进行导入,最后想到手写一个java服务迁移。使用命令行方式导入db2的导出方式先连接db2数据db2 connect to 数据库名导出命令 chardel"表示双引号为字段定界符 c
转载 2023-07-10 22:29:15
210阅读
任何数据库都是这样的,我们会做数据库的全量备份,增量备份,差异备份,并记录日志。如果数据库出现意外宕机,则可以用全备+增量备份+日志来进行数据库恢复。 常用的三种备份方式全量备份完全备份(full backup)」,如果两个时间点备份之间,数据没有任何更动,那么它也只是机械性地将每个数据库内容读出、写入,不管数据有没有被修改过。如果每天变动的数据库内容只有 10 MB,每晚却要花费 10
前言:  数据备份的重要性:提高系统的高可用性和灾难可恢复性;(在数据库系统崩溃的时候,没有数据备份怎么办!)使用数据备份还原数据库是数据库系统崩溃时提供数据恢复最小代价的最优方案;(总不能让客户重新填报数据吧!)没有数据就没有一切,数据备份就是一种防范灾难于未然的强力手段;对于DBA来说,最首要也是最重要的任务就是数据备份。一、 数据备份的方式和分类:按照数据备份数据库的使用影响来
转载 2024-05-02 11:43:18
63阅读
环境 cenos 7.0db2版本 db2_v101_linuxx64_expc.tar 安装db2解压db2tar zxvf db2_v101_linuxx64_expc.tarcd expc检查安装db2所需要的依赖是否都安装,没安装的补全./db2prereqcheck    &nb
转载 2024-08-19 14:01:50
53阅读
[数据库][57019][错误]数据库的57019错误 7. 01. 查询数据库的日志,看到以下的错误: 2008-11-28-02.11.02.695011+480 E1354769G715 LEVEL: Severe PID : 32594 TID : 3009411984 PROC : db2acd INSTANCE: db2inst1
转载 2024-04-02 10:31:54
131阅读
 DB2备份恢复读书笔记 1.DB2三种备份恢复机制 (1)紧急事故恢复:基本就是断电后重启,根据日志自动redo或者undo,恢复数据一致状态。 (2)版本恢复:恢复整个DB2备份。 (3)前滚恢复:在版本恢复的基础上,应用日志,恢复某个点上。日志启动归档日志。 2.DB2日志 (1)预写式:在具体化数据库之前,
转载 2024-06-17 04:58:01
91阅读
DB2离线和在线全备、增量备份及恢复的操作步骤 1、离线全备份 1)、首先确保没有用户使用DB2: $db2 list applications for db sample 2)、停掉数据库并重新启动,以便断掉所有连接: db2stop force db2start 3)、执行备份命令:(使用TSM作为备份的介质) db2 backup db sample use tsm 备份
转载 2024-02-27 15:38:35
302阅读
数据备份创建了数据库的时间点映象,它是灾难恢复解决方案的基本组件。DB2 提供了几种备份,包括脱机备份、联机备份和增量备份。从备份恢复所需的时间取决于数据库的大小和可用于执行恢复的硬件资源。 由于数据备份只捕获时间点的数据,因此无法通过一个简单恢复来恢复备份之后发生的任何数据更改。要恢复备份之后完成的事务,就需要应用日志文件。可以从备份和日志文件(通过在日志文件中进行“前
备份恢复DB2数据库步骤 一、设置归档参数:   1、db2 update db cfg for using mirrorlogpath /home/db2inst1/mirror_log/ //mirror log   2db2 get db cfg for //确认是否成功   3、db2 update db cfg for using userexit on //启用用户出口  
转载 2024-05-22 16:21:14
378阅读
进入DB2的安装目录,例如 D:/Program Files/IBM/SQLLIB/BIN,打开命令行窗口。或直接windows+R输入db2cmd初始化命令行环境。 一、离线全备①     连接一个已建立好的数据库,做一个离线的全备。命令:DB2 CONNECT TO DATABASE_NAME这时会显示数据库连接信息。②&n
转载 2024-03-06 12:21:33
81阅读
DB2数据库自动备份详解  1)请先保证你的DB2数据库已安装,且运行正常2) 在开始->运行,输入命令db2cmd,打开一个新的db2命令窗口: 在DB2的“命令窗口”执行下面语句创建备份运行数据db2 create tools catalog cc create new database toolsdb目的是创建一个命名为toolsdb的数据库,用来存放任
一、db2备份数据一般用到backup 和 restore [quote] 1、backup db databasename to [driver] restore db databasename from [driver] 2、restore db databasename from [driver] into dbrename [
转载 2023-10-17 05:31:25
532阅读
DB2离线和在线全备、增量备份及恢复的操作步骤 1、离线全备份 1)、首先确保没有用户使用DB2: $db2 list applications for db sample 2)、停掉数据库并重新启动,以便断掉所有连接: db2stop force db2start 3)、执行备份命令:(使用TSM作为备
转载 2024-02-27 12:50:43
134阅读
本文记录DB2常用的备份、还原及其他常用命令(错别字见谅,后续会更新)一、备份1、离线备份:先切断数据库链接db2 force application all全量备份数据库至某个目录db2 backup db dbname to d:2、在线备份开启在线备份的日志归档db2 update db cfg for dbname using logarchmeth1 "Disk:d:\db2arch"&
DB2数据备份与恢复  所谓数据备份,就是保留一套备用系统,当运行系统出现故障时,能够以最小的时间恢复原来的数据数据库的备份,可以是整个数据库的拷贝,也可以是其中一部分数据的拷贝(一个或多个表空间)。数据备份一般有两个层次:硬件级备份:用冗余的硬件来保证系统的连续运行,比如双机容错、硬盘镜像等方式。如果主硬件损坏,后备硬件能够立刻接替其工作。 软件级备份:将系统数据保存到其他可以移动
DB2数据备份的方式与分类按照数据备份数据库的使用影响来划分:联机备份(也称热备份或在线备份)      脱机备份(也称冷备份或离线备份)按照数据库的数据备份范围来划分:完全备份——备份数据库中的所有数据      增量备份——备份数据库中的部分数据增量备份的两种实现方式:增量备份(也称累计备
转载 2024-03-06 16:21:41
71阅读
  1、更改数据库参数 logretain, userexit, trackmod 为 on   2、更改参数之后完全离线备份数据库一次   3、之后就可以进行在线、在线增量备份了   测试结果通过,脚本如下。   重要!数据库归档日志必须按时备份至另一个地方,本例中为 C:/TESTDB.0/SQLOGDIR ------------------------------------------
DB2数据库离线和在线全备、增量备份及恢复的具体操作步骤:   1、离线全备份  (1)、首先确保没有用户使用DB2:  $db2 list applications for db sample  (2)、停掉数据库并重新启动,以便断掉所有连接:  db2stop force  db2start  (3)、执行备份命令:(使用TSM作为备份的介质)  db2 backup db sample us
转载 2024-02-29 11:31:37
67阅读
将整个文件夹(JMAM_DQ.0)放到D:\db_bak\开始-运行,输入db2cmd:1.创建数据db2 create db dbname on d: (数据库在D盘,这时系统会自动新增SQL0000*目录,结果目录如:D:\DB2\NODE0000\SQL0000*\....;如果远程连接数据库创建,则在执行create 前先执行 db2 attach to servernode
  • 1
  • 2
  • 3
  • 4
  • 5